From George Washington to Major James Parr, 11 May 1779

To Major James Parr

Head Qrs Middle Brook May 11th 1779

sir

As the exigencies of the service require, that the Two Rifle companies should continue detached from the Main Army for some short time—I request that you will remain with them, till you are farther advised by me.1 I am Sir Yr Most Obedt servant

Go: Washington

Df, in Robert Hanson Harrison’s writing, DLC:GW; Varick transcript, DLC:GW.

1Parr’s rifle detachment would continue to operate semi-independently, mostly on the Pennsylvania frontier, until 1781.
